Components Of Plumbing System
Plumbing is an essential element of any home, providing clean water and safe waste disposal. Without plumbing, it would be virtually impossible for any home to remain healthy. Plumbing systems are complex structures made up of numerous components working together in perfect harmony. Astonishingly, these components have been operating successfully for centuries, keeping households safe and sound.
The core component of any plumbing system is the pipes that channel water throughout the house. These pipes come in different sizes and materials such as copper, plastic or galvanized steel. Each type of pipe has its own set of advantages, but all must meet local regulations regarding safety and health standards. The pipes must also connect to a reliable source of water, usually a municipal water supply or well pump.
The other main parts of a plumbing system include valves, faucets and fixtures such as toilets and sinks. Valves control the flow of water through the pipes while faucets provide easy access for users. Fixtures allow users to conveniently use the plumbing system for personal hygiene or other needs. All these components must be properly installed and regularly maintained in order to ensure that they are functioning correctly and not causing any health issues.
With proper installation and regular maintenance, a plumbing system can keep homes healthy for years to come by providing clean water and safely disposing wastewater away from the living areas

Common Problems And How To Fix Them
A plumbing problem can be a major disruption to everyday life and cause significant discomfort. Unfortunately, it is all too common for homeowners to experience some kind of plumbing issue at least once in their lives. From clogged drains to water leaks, understanding the common problems and how to address them will help keep your home healthy and safe.
A clogged drain is one of the most frequent issues faced by homeowners. This often occurs when debris accumulates inside the drain and blocks water from passing through freely. To fix this, use a plunger or an auger to push the blockage out of the pipes. If these methods do not provide successful results, then contact a plumbing professional to assist in clearing up the issue.
Water leaks are another common problem that require attention, as they can lead to extensive damage if left untreated. Many times this is caused by defective seals or worn-out fixtures that need replacing. Additionally, it is important to inspect pipes regularly for any signs of corrosion or fractures that may need repair. If any evidence of leakage is found, contact a professional immediately so they can make appropriate repairs before further damage occurs.
